What’s the difference between an eggroll and a spring roll?

Spring rolls are wrapped in thin flour wrappers or rice wrappers, while egg rolls are wrapped in a thicker, noticeably crispier wrapper that’s been dipped in egg for richness. Preparation. Egg rolls are fried, which accounts for their bubbly, crispy exteriors.

Which is healthier spring rolls or egg rolls?

What’s healthier spring roll vs egg roll? Spring rolls are a healthier alternative to egg rolls. While both have cabbage in them, spring rolls will usually have additional vegetables in them while egg rolls will almost always have pork in them. Spring roll wrappers are also thinner and don’t have egg in the pastry.

What is a fresh spring roll?

Fresh spring rolls are cold Vietnamese rolls (obviously not cooked). They are made with rice paper wraps and are typically filled with cooked prawns, lettuce, carrot, Thai basil , mint, and cilantro.

Why is a spring roll called a spring roll?

Originally made for Chinese New Year banquets, spring rolls were stacked to look like bars of gold. Spring rolls got their name because the New Year marks the start of spring in the lunar calendar. Spring rolls have a paper-thin wrapper that’s made from flour and water.

Do you eat rice paper on spring rolls?

Rice paper is sold in dried sheets. Before using them, you will need to rehydrate them to make them pliable. Once rehydrated, rice paper can be eaten as is — like with summer rolls — or fried.

Do spring rolls have egg in them?

Spring roll dough contains no egg, making it lighter and crispier than the egg roll when fried. As far as difference in fillings, egg rolls are typically filled with cooked cabbage, some other vegetables, and pork, while spring rolls are often simply filled with cooked vegetables.
